Charles W. Cox, age 77 of Malvern, died Monday, January 5, 2015. He was born in Willow, Arkansas on January 27, 1937 to the late Walter Cox and Iona Jones Cox. Reared and receiving his early education in Carthage, Arkansas, he was a longtime resident of Malvern. A former parts manager for Grady Jones, Charles was a past member of the North Little Rock Jaycees. He was a member of St. Paul United Methodist Church
He is survived by a son, Alan Cox of North Little Rock; by a daughter and son-in-law, Terri and Doug Smith of Mabelvale; by four grandchildren, and eight great-grandchildren.
Charles was also preceded in death by a brother, William (Billy) Cox, and a sister, Betty Jo Cox Lyons.
Graveside service will be at one o'clock Saturday afternoon, January 10, 2015 at the Cypress Cemetery in Willow, with Reverend Dooley Fowler officiating.
The family expresses their grateful appreciation to the administration and staff of Malvern Nursing Home for the care they gave Mr. Cox during his years of residency.
Memorials may be made to St. Paul United Methodist Church, 1310 E. Mill Street, Malvern, AR 72104.
